Study on Efficiency and Influencing Factors of Groundwater Overexploitation in Arid Area ——Based on Empirical Study of 49 Counties in Hebei Province

Résumé partiel
Hebei Province,in the North China Plain region of China,is an important grain production base in China.Hebei province has a special geographical climate leading to low rainfall there every year,so surface water resources are very scarce.In 2014,the government of Hebei Province began to respond to the call of the central government to carry out pilot work on groundwater overdraft management in the province.In this paper,using the groundwater overdraft management data of 49 counties and districts in four cities in Hebei Province from 2016 to 2019,the game crossover model was used to measure the comprehensive efficiency of groundwater management in each region and the management efficiency of various specific projects,respectively.Further,a truncated regression model was used to analyze the effects of human,natural and economic and social factors on the efficiency of groundwater management.In order to provide a scientific and reliable basis for the subsequent groundwater management work in North China and even in the whole country.The main findings of the article are as follows.(1)The overall efficiency values of groundwater overdraft management in the sample counties and districts during the study period are at a high level,but at the same time characterized by large differences between regions.From the four pilot cities,Hengshui and Handan are less effective than Cangzhou and Xingtai,but their comprehensive management efficiency is on a significant upward trend.(2)The comprehensive efficiency of the four types of agricultural treatment projects in Hebei province fluctuated around 0.7 during the study period,among which the efficiency values of water-saving irrigation,agronomic water-saving,and water diversion and replenishment projects had a small decrease,but the overall trend was positive,and the efficiency of the adjustment of planting structure project increased in fluctuation.The average efficiency value of each project is above 0.7,among which the best performance is in adjusting planting structure,followed by agronomic water conservation projects,among which the lowest average efficiency value is in water diversion and source replenishment projects.(3)Groundwater management efficiency shows spatial distribution differences.The governance of deep groundwater general over-extraction area is significantly greater than that of other types of over-extraction areas.(4)Groundwater extraction,surface water volume,population size and the proportion of agriculture in all industries inhibit the improvement of groundwater governance efficiency,while annual precipitation,well irrigation regression and the proportion of financial expenditure are important factors to improve groundwater governance efficiency.Analysis of the regression results by type of overdraft shows that the effects of various indicators on different degrees of extraction zones are largely significant,and only the indicator of the proportion of agriculture becomes no longer significant for the deep overdraft zone.In addition,the absolute values of the coefficient values of various influencing factors on the deep overdraft zone are larger,indicating that the effects of various indicators on the deep overdraft zone are more significant.

Mots clés : Groundwater over-exploitation ;Integrated Governance Efficiency ;DEA Game Cross-Efficiency Model ;Truncated regression model ;
